Low-sugar sweet curd dessert provides 128 calories per 100 g. It also contains 11.2 g of protein, 7.4 g of carbohydrates, and 5.8 g of fat per 100 g.
It has a glycemic index of 32 and contains 7.4 g of carbohydrates per 100 g. It is compatible with vegetarian, gluten-free, Mediterranean, flexitarian, and omnivore eating patterns, but contains dairy.
